When writing always remember… a character flaw is only a flaw until becomes useful. 

Is your protagonist manipulative? Well that’s awful… until they manipulate the antagonist into making a decision that saves the lives of their friends. 

Is your protagonist a skeptic? Well that’s not good… until someone tries to lie to them. 

Is your protagonist overprotective? That sucks… until someone they love is in danger. 

Is your protagonist remorseless? Well that makes them pretty unlikeable… until a hard decision has to be made.

Not everyone gets to quarantine. Not everyone has a WFH job.

Some people are running the “essential” stores that people come to every day to browse idly because “everywhere else is closed!” Some people are throwing up stock of bleach and TP and canned food only to turn around and see the stock has vanished behind them.

Some people are stuck working for companies with no paid sick leave, or they are offered paid sick leave… if you get diagnosed with covid-19. And none of us can even get tested in most states even if we show symptoms due to the draconian guidelines on who gets a test.

Some of us are immunocompromised or live with elderly family and are fucking terrified of carrying covid home with us.

Some of us are “lucky” and are getting increased wages during this period. But it’s up in the air if that makes this shit worth it, and most of us don’t get that.

Regardless, I want to establish one thing: No one who works retail asked to be “essential” services. And none of us were trained for this and none of us are being paid enough for this.

Personally, I have enjoyed my job up until covid happened because I’m an incredibly anxious person, and my store was a quiet one, and I was good at my job. It was a calm environment to work in, and I was happy to find it.

Now, I’m having repeated crying jags in the stock room and looking up how to qualify for unemployment and not seeing a way out. I handle the money for the store deposit almost every night, and I intimately know my store is making at minimum 4x usual profit and some days 6x or 7x more.

My point in this post is that I know I’m not alone. I have two friends in similar straits who are also on the verge of breaking down. We can’t sustain this.

The rallying cry of “paid sick leave” doesn’t mean shit if it comes with the caveat that you have to test positive for a virus you can’t get tested for. And while I am trying very hard to be sympathetic to the people who are isolating, who are lonely, who are struggling, I feel like “essential” workers are being thrown in the woodchipper.

And it becomes very hard to hold onto that sympathy when people just! come into our stores! to walk around! Maybe if fewer people did that, maybe if my store stopped making astronomical amounts of money, we’d close for a few days. But nope.

Please start yelling loudly for hazard pay for essential workers. Please start yelling for testing for everyone so we can fucking go home. Please stop talking about how “brave” we are and help us.

That’s all. This is a post for my fellow low wage workers who woke up one day and found out they’re essential staff, retail or EMTs or gas station workers or whoever you are. This is bullshit and we’re tired and we need help. Before we all burn out.
